A major gathering of digital marketing leaders, creatives, agency owners, and tech innovators took place at the Google AI Center, where experts explored how artificial intelligence is reshaping the future of marketing. The digital marketers conference brought together professionals from across the industry to exchange insights, discuss emerging trends, and understand how AI is transforming advertising, content creation, and customer engagement.
Key Highlights From the Conference
AI as a Driving Force for Marketing Innovation
Speakers emphasized that AI is no longer an experimental tool. It is now a core part of modern marketing workflows, from data analytics and content generation to automation and personalization. The event showcased how even small businesses can now access advanced capabilities that were once limited to enterprise-level companies.
Opening Keynote: The Power of Niche and AI Collaboration
The keynote session encouraged marketers to rethink their approach to growth. Instead of trying to appeal to everyone, experts advised focusing on niche markets and using AI to amplify efficiency. With AI handling tasks like drafting copy, analyzing customer behavior and creating visual assets, marketers can now prioritize creativity and strategy.
AI Levels the Playing Field for SMEs
A major theme of the conference was the democratization of marketing tools. AI-powered design platforms, automated campaign builders and predictive analytics make it possible for small agencies and solo marketers to compete with much larger competitors. This shift is expected to dramatically increase competition in the digital space over the next five years.
Human Creativity Remains Irreplaceable
Despite rapid advancements, speakers stressed that AI is not a replacement for marketers. Human insight, storytelling, emotional intelligence and strategic thinking remain central to any successful campaign. AI provides assistance. Marketers provide direction.
